Our February 9th Program features attorneys Nancy Walter and Patricia Bovan of the Queen's Bench Bar Association (www.queensbench.org) , who will tell us about the JUVENILE HALL PROJECT.

The Queen's Bench Juvenile Hall Project volunteers at the San Francisco Juvenile Hall at 375 Woodside Avenue (off Portola) on the 1st and 3rd Wednesday of every month, from 7:00 to 9:00 p.m. in Unit #5. They provide companionship, enrichment activities and mentoring to pre-teen and teenage girls in lock up. These children have historically been subjected to violent victimization.

Soroptimist Int of San Francisco has partnered with Queen's Bench for the last two Decembers co-hosting a Holiday Party for the girls at Juvenile Hall, providing gifts, activities and pizza.

Soroptimist International is an organization of business and professional women and men who provide volunteer services in their communities.

Soroptimist International of San Francisco is the second oldest club in the world, chartered March 6 1922. We have been improving the lives of  women and girls in San Francisco since 1922.
